Output 25cfca8c026f939a1371d3623fd7955d4a7ce3f9befda2ffe4a2caafbbbd6bd2:0

value
683963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d01e4123410778723349df60673c6e3e64af993 OP_EQUAL
address
3LNziFXM78KhibDKzRrZ8i9MphjFFMWXyD
transaction
25cfca8c026f939a1371d3623fd7955d4a7ce3f9befda2ffe4a2caafbbbd6bd2
confirmations
403195
spent
true